Dillard High School is a historic public middle and high school located in Fort Lauderdale, Florida. The school was established in 1907 as Colored School 11 and was later named for black-education advocate James H. Dillard . [ 2 ]

Dillard is an unincorporated community in Stokes County, North Carolina. The center of Dillard is where Highway 772 and Dillard Road cross. Nearby communities include Pine Hall , Walnut Cove , Madison , Prestonville , and Danbury .
The wavelength of visible light waves varies between 400 and 700 nm, but the term "light" is also often applied to infrared (0.7–300 μm) and ultraviolet radiation (10–400 nm). The wave model can be used to make predictions about how an optical system will behave without requiring an explanation of what is "waving" in what medium.
